What "across the country approved" actually means

In Australia, nationally accredited courses are controlled and listed on the nationwide register, either as qualifications within the Australian Qualifications Framework or as across the country acknowledged courses for details capability. These are provided by Registered Educating Organisations, and must fulfill the requirements applied by the Australian Skills High quality Authority, usually described as ASQA. When you complete one, you get a Statement of Achievement or a certification that is portable across states and acknowledged by companies that require certified training.

That transportability issues. A certificate from a weekend break workshop without any accreditation might be useful as expert advancement, but it will not fulfill conformity needs for a mental health support officer duty, a community services audit, or a purchase panel requesting for nationally accredited courses. If you see "ASQA accredited courses" in the company's copy, you still want to confirm the training course code and inspect the RTO number on training.gov.au. This takes two minutes and saves a lot of guesswork.

Where the 11379NAT course fits

The 11379NAT Course in Initial Response to a Mental Health Crisis sits directly in the "first feedback" room. It is a nationally accredited training product created to instruct participants how to recognise, reply to, and seek aid for a mental health crisis in its very early minutes. Different RTOs brand it a little in a different way, so you might see language like 11379NAT mental health course, mental health course 11379NAT, emergency treatment course mental health, or first aid mental health training. The end results correspond throughout credible carriers because the proficiencies and analysis needs are defined.

You will occasionally see the course described as "first aid for mental health," which is a helpful shorthand. The example holds. You are not identifying or treating. You are stabilising, preserving safety and security, supplying prompt assistance, and connecting the individual with recurring expert treatment. An excellent 11379NAT mental health support course gives you a structure that is straightforward sufficient to remember under stress, and nuanced sufficient to prevent robotic or hazardous responses.

What "initial reaction" training in fact covers

When showed well, the 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is take care of the kinds of situations most work environments and area settings experience. Think about a team member experiencing an anxiety attack and hyperventilating in a warehouse. A client that ends up being very perturbed, loud, and paranoid. A teen in a school yard who discloses self damage. A colleague cold up and going blank during a change handover after weeks of sleeplessness. The program furnishes you to recognise indicators and patterns, engage safely, and move toward professional help.

Core content normally consists of:

    Practical safety and security planning genuine areas: leaves, view lines, spectator monitoring, and your very own body language. Communication under anxiety: basing techniques, short sentences, and exactly how to rate your voice so you do not rise the situation. Crisis differentiation: what is a mental health crisis and what is not. As an example, the distinction between intense unhappiness, a panic episode, and a prompt self-destruction risk. Escalation thresholds: when to call a manager, a dilemma line, an ambulance, or cops, and exactly how to do it with marginal harm. Cultural and trauma recognition: exactly how previous trauma, language, or cultural norms change what "useful" looks like.

In analysis, you need to anticipate scenarios, not simply quizzes. I have beinged in evaluations where the duty play is so surface that the pupil simply asks, "Are you all right?" and then calls the helpline. That will not cut it when you are alone on a graveyard shift with a troubled customer. Try to find scenario depth. In an excellent assessment, the individual in situation could refuse assistance, disperse, or rise. You will certainly need to make a decision whether to decrease or step up, and you will require to justify your choices.

The refresher course: why 11379NAT is not a set-and-forget

Many RTOs use a 11379NAT mental health correspondence course, often described as mental health refresher course 11379NAT or merely mental health refresher. Commonly, the refresher course is suggested every 12 to 24 months. That cadence mirrors fact. Skills like de-escalation and threat analysis break down without technique. Team turnover disrupts continuity. Plan and sources change, consisting of local referral pathways and state mental health crisis lines. A refresher does not re-teach whatever. It concentrates on updates, drills, and the common weak points seen in the field.

I have actually seen a warehouse manager return for a refresher after 18 months and state, "This time I observed just how quick I chat when someone is panicking." That tiny self-awareness shift can transform outcomes. Refreshers likewise fix drift. Teams develop unofficial faster ways that could weaken security, like relocating somebody to a peaceful space without a 2nd staff psychosocial risk factors at work member existing. A refresher course places framework back in place.

How "first aid for mental health" varies from scientific training

First help in psychological health and wellness is about instant, non clinical assistance that shields life and self-respect and bridges to expert care. You are not there to interpret medication plans or supply treatment. The activity is front packed: recognise, involve, examine instant danger, assistance, and refer. That is why the layout is sensible. You practice tough discussions. You find out basing strategies. You practice calling a crisis line and rundown them. You do not examine DSM criteria.

There is an all-natural boundary here. If you routinely carry out detailed instance management, run teams, or supply recurring psychosocial interventions, you will desire a formal occupation certification in social work, psychological health, or alcohol and other drugs together with first response training. Yet also in those deeper roles, a crisis mental health course or first aid mental health course includes rate and framework for high stress situations.

What is a mental health crisis, really

The expression gets sprayed. A useful definition: a mental health crisis is a state where a person's psychological distress and symptoms produce prompt threat to safety and security, operating, or dignity, and immediate support is required. That can consist of impending self-destruction risk, severe panic with physical hyperarousal, severe psychosis with high frustration, aggressive habits driven by hallucinations or persecutory ideas, serious dissociation, or complicated sorrow tipping somebody right into self harm. The vital differentiator is immediacy and risk.

Edge situations issue. An individual crying at their workdesk is not instantly in crisis. An individual texting bye-bye messages on a lunch break could be. A customer loudly whining is frequently not a dilemma. A client punching walls near exits may be. Good courses in mental health teach you to sort signal from sound without pathologising regular human difficulty.

What good method looks like on the day

During a live situation, efficient responders do a few points constantly. They orient to safety quietly and early: place themselves in between the individual and the exit just if safety demands it, keep their hands noticeable, and make use of open position. They talk much less than they believe they require to. They mirror back what they listen to without including spin. They ask straight concerns concerning risk without apologising for asking. They signify that assistance is readily available and name the next step with specifics, not obscure promises.

I viewed a team leader support a brand-new staff member that iced up throughout a panic spike on day 3 of the work. The leader moved the person to a peaceful, noticeable space near the front workdesk where various other staff remained in sight. She reduced her voice and asked, "Are you feeling hazardous right now?" The individual drank their head. "Are you having thoughts about injuring yourself?" A time out, after that a no. "Can I call the nurse at work to come rest with us while we help your breathing work out?" A nod. 3 mins later, the registered nurse arrived. The leader had already briefed her in two sentences and handed over calmly. That is what these training courses practice till it feels natural.

Where individuals go wrong

Common blunders repeat throughout workplaces:

    Over talking. In a crisis, lengthy descriptions and layers of reassurance usually backfire. A clear sentence beats five soothing ones. Jumping to cops too early or too late. The threshold for cops participation must be tied to imminent risks that can not handle, not discomfort with distress. Ignoring environmental stressors. Intense lights, crowded corridors, or cornered settings can rise symptoms rapidly. Training that drills location selections pays off. Treating mental health and wellness emergency treatment like HR mediation. A crisis reaction is not the time to address group disputes or performance issues. First protect safety, then escalate to proper networks later. Failing to comply with up. After an event, debrief with your group, update the assistance strategy, and check in with the person, if appropriate and risk-free. Training courses that consist of blog post occurrence refines established much better habits.

Documentation that shields individuals and organizations

After any kind of significant occurrence, record what occurred, what you observed, what you asked, and what activities you took. Keep it valid. Prevent labels or medical diagnoses. "Client was pacing, clenching fists, speaking noisally regarding being complied with" is useful. "Customer was psychotic" is not. Keep in mind the referral or handover information, consisting of times and the name of the person you briefed. Great courses in mental health consist of themes for this. If your own does not, ask for one.

Documentation protects the person by developing connection throughout changes and solutions. It protects team by revealing that policies were complied with and threat was considered. It safeguards the company during audits and case testimonials. In numerous industries, the lack of documentation counts as the absence of treatment, regardless of what actually occurred.
